		<description> I own a drilling company in Texas.  Most water bearing formations that produce clean drinkable water are thousands of feet shallower than the oil and gas formations that are being fracked.  Fracking wings that result cannot only reach a few hundred feet.  The only real way to pollute one of these water formations is for the drilling company to fail to properly complete the well which is a separate step of oil and gas extraction and has nothing to do with fracking.  Each state has its own agency that regulates the completion process to make sure it is done correctly.  And lets remember that if an oil company allows the oil and gas to pollute a water formation is is losing the very oil and gas it intends to sell for a profit.</description>
